How they compare

Peru currently reports 2,580 1000 ha against 2,442 1000 ha in Myanmar, a difference of 138 1000 ha.

That makes Peru's figure about 1.1 times Myanmar's.

Across all 64 years both countries report, Peru has been ahead every year.

Myanmar ranks 28th and Peru ranks 27th of 201 countries.

Peru has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Myanmar Peru Difference Ahead
1960s 732.33 1000 ha 1,078 1000 ha 345.67 1000 ha Peru
1970s 940.5 1000 ha 1,320 1000 ha 379.9 1000 ha Peru
1980s 1,041 1000 ha 1,530 1000 ha 489.7 1000 ha Peru
1990s 1,346 1000 ha 1,779 1000 ha 433.4 1000 ha Peru
2000s 2,108 1000 ha 2,225 1000 ha 116.7 1000 ha Peru
2010s 2,298 1000 ha 2,565 1000 ha 267.24 1000 ha Peru
2020s 2,332 1000 ha 2,580 1000 ha 248.25 1000 ha Peru

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The FAOSTAT Land Use domain contains data on twenty-one land use categories and twenty-three categories of irrigation and agricultural practices. Data are available yearly and by country, regional and global levels. The domain includes Land Use Indicators providing information on the percentage share of agricultural and forest land, and their sub-components, including irrigated areas and areas under organic agriculture, within a country land use matrix. Data are available at country, regional and global level, for the following elements: (in percentage) i) Share in Land area; ii) Share in Agricultural land, iii) Share in Cropland; and iv) Share in Forest land; (in ha/pc) v) Area per capita.
